FOREST GRANT


  Forest (Babe) Grant, 53, of Albright Shores, died Saturday, July 14, in the Saginaw Veterans Hospital following a brief illness. Born March 21, 1920, at Mt. Forest, Mich., he served in the U.S. Coast Guard during World War II. Mr. Grant was employed at Dow Chemical in Midland. He had been a resident of Gladwin County for 25 years. He was a member of the Midland VFW.

  Surviving are his mother, Mrs. Merle (Lillian) Crawford of Beaverton; a brother, Kenneth of Midland; and a sister, Beaulah Mae Grant of Lake; 1 step-son, Samuel Bailey of Midland. Services were held Tuesday at 11 a.m. at St. Anne Catholic Church, Edenville, and burial was in Billings Township Cemetery. The Rev. Fr. Kawka officiated. Arrangements were in charge of Hall's Funeral Home..
